In UI design, there are several key elements and best practices that contribute to creating visually appealing and intuitive interfaces. Let's dive into a few of these elements:

1. Color: Color plays a vital role in UI design as it can evoke emotions, create visual hierarchy, and communicate information. It's essential to choose a color scheme that aligns with the brand and creates a pleasant user experience. For example, using a contrasting color for call-to-action buttons can make them stand out and entice users to take action.

2. Typography: Typography is another crucial element in UI design. It involves selecting the right fonts, font sizes, and line spacing to ensure readability and enhance the overall visual appeal. For instance, using a clear and easy-to-read font for body text and a bolder font for headings can make the content more scannable and engaging.

3. Layout: The layout plays a significant role in organizing information and guiding users through the interface. It's important to create a logical and consistent layout that is easy to navigate. For example, placing important elements at the top or left side of the screen, known as the F-shape pattern, can catch users' attention faster.

Remember, utilizing these UI design elements should not be done in isolation. It's crucial to consider how they work together to create a cohesive and visually appealing interface.

Best Practices:

  • Keep the interface simple and clutter-free. Avoid unnecessary elements that may confuse or overwhelm users.
  • Ensure consistency in visual elements, such as buttons, icons, and navigation, throughout the interface.
  • Prioritize mobile responsiveness by designing for various screen sizes and resolutions.
